The tour departs early in the morning at 7:00 am from 04210 Valensole, a scenic village known for its expansive lavender fields. Pickup is available from Marseille, Aix-en-Provence, or your specified address, which makes this flexible and convenient for travelers staying in these areas. The transportation is in a com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le, a real plus given the summertime heat and the rural routes.
While the tour typically lasts between 4 to 6 hours, the exact timing can be tailored to your preferences, especially if you’re booking a full-day experience. The private nature of the tour means your guide can adjust the itinerary slightly—perhaps spending more time in spots you love or adding a quick stop at a local shop.
Once on the road, you’ll drift through rolling Provençal landscapes, with your guide sharing insights about the region’s history and the significance of lavender farming. The scenery alone is enough to make this trip worthwhile—vast fields of violet stretching to the horizon, with the scent filling the air.

Is transportation included?
Yes, transportation from Marseille, Aix-en-Provence, or other addresses is included in the tour. You’ll travel in a com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le.
Can I visit the lavender museum?
Absolutely. The tour offers an optional visit to the Occitane Lavender Museum, which many find a valuable addition to the scenic drive.
What’s the best time to go?
Lavender fields bloom primarily from July into early August. Booking well in advance is recommended, as this is peak season and highly popular.
How long does the tour last?
The tour lasts approximately 4 to 6 hours, with flexibility for full-day options depending on your preferences.
Is this a group or private experience?
It’s a completely private tour for your group only, ensuring personalized attention and a relaxed pace.
What if the weather is bad?
Since the experience depends on good weather for optimal views, it’s weather-dependent. You can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before, and in case of poor weather, options include rescheduling or full refund.
